Abstract
Optical TDM allows multiple traffic streams to share the bandwidth of a wavelength. This paper presents a framework for determining the capacity and routing strategy needed to establish different logical topologies on an optical TDM ring network with propagation delay but no Optical Time Slot Interchange (OTSI); OTSI requires optical buffering which is not practical at the current time. We show that an optical TDM ring is characterized by a parameter called cycle length. The impact of the cycle length on the capacity of a bi-directional optical TDM ring is evaluated and joint routing and time-slot assignment strategies are developed.
